[Backport] Security bug 1401571102-based
Manual update of libdav1d to match the version introduced by patch
https://chromium-review.googlesource.com/c/chromium/src/+/4114163:
Roll src/third_party/dav1d/libdav1d/ 87f9a81cd..ed63a7459 (104 commits)
This roll required a few changes to get working:
- "properties" => "built in options" crossfile configuration change due to Meson deprecation.
- generic config creation never worked, so fixed.
- PPC64 configs were never checked in, so switched to generic.
- copyright header changes for generate_sources.
- Updated readme.chromium with potential issues that can arise.
